Re: [PATCH 1/2] rust: dma: remove DMA_ATTR_NO_KERNEL_MAPPING from public attrs

On Sun Mar 22, 2026 at 2:27 AM JST, Danilo Krummrich wrote:
> When DMA_ATTR_NO_KERNEL_MAPPING is passed to dma_alloc_attrs(), the
> returned CPU address is not a pointer to the allocated memory but an
> opaque handle (e.g. struct page *).
>
> Coherent<T> (or CoherentAllocation<T> respectively) stores this value as
> NonNull<T> and exposes methods that dereference it and even modify its
> contents.
>
> Remove the flag from the public attrs module such that drivers cannot
> pass it to Coherent<T> (or CoherentAllocation<T> respectively) in the
> first place.
>
> Instead DMA_ATTR_NO_KERNEL_MAPPING can be supported with an additional
> opaque type (e.g. CoherentHandle) which does not provide access to the
> allocated memory.
